The Donaldson Family have been seriously involved in viticulture and winemaking for over 40 years. Founder Ivan Donaldson planted the first Canterbury vineyard in 1976 and went on to establish Pegasus Bay in 1986 with his wife Christine. It is a true family business, with all four of their sons now involved.

The grapes were picked in mid-May to select bunches with between 30-50% botrytis. The grapes were then gently pressed and the juice fermented slowly at cool temperatures to help the wine retain its vibrant fruit characters and varietal purity. At all stages, from fermentation to bottling, it was handled very carefully to help retain a little of its natural carbon dioxide. This has resulted in a small amount of spritzig, which adds extra liveliness to the wine and accentuates its freshness.

Upon release the colour is bright lemon. The bouquet is a tantalising patchwork of apricot, marmalade, honey and orange zest, interwoven with fl oral notes and a lick of ginger. The botrytis has added concentration and richness, yet there is a refreshing zestiness backed with bright acidity that teases the palate, ensuring the wine remains lively and well balanced, with a prolonged finish.
